13.3) Requirements on the oil- and venting lines
Oil lines
Oil circuit, engine (main oil pump)
➪ Temperature durability: mind. 130°C (266 ° F)
➪ Pressure durability: mind. 10 bar (145 p.s.i.)
➪ Bending radius: mind. 70 mm (2,75 in.)
➪ Minimum inside dia. of oil lines in reference to total length
length up to ...1m (3 ') min. 11 mm ø (.43")
length up to ...2 m (6' 6") min. 12 mm ø (.47")
length up to ...3 m (10') min. 13 mm ø (.51")
Oil circuit, turbo charger (suction pump)
➪ Temperature durability: mind. 130°C (266 ° F)
➪ Pressure durability: mind. 10 bar (145 p.s.i.)
➪ Bending radius: mind. 70 mm (2,75 in.)
➪ Minimum inside dia. of oil lines in reference to total length
length up to ...1m (3 ') min. 11 mm ø (.43")
length up to ...2 m (6' 6") min. 12 mm ø (.47")
Venting line of oil tank
See ill. 22.
➪ Route the line without kinks and avoid sharp bends.
◆ NOTE: Water is a by-product of combustion. Most of this water will dissipate
from the combustion chamber with the exhaust gases.
A small amount will reach the crankcase and has to be disposed
through the venting line of oil tank via oil return line.
➪ The venting line must be routed in a continuous decline or furnished with a drain
bore at it's lowest point to drain possible condensate.
➪ The venting line has to be protected from any kind of ice
formation in the condensate. Protection by insulation, or routing
in a hose with hot air flow or by furnishing venting line with a
bypass opening Q before passing through cowling W. See ill.
23.
